The same color needs a different cmyk build depending on the paper. Here is #ead595 on both.

Coated stockgloss or silk, C
0 9 36 8
Ink sits on the surface, so colors stay bright and close to screen.
Uncoated stocknatural or matte, U
4 12 37 14
The stock absorbs ink and gains dot, so it needs a heavier build and reads a touch softer.

How we calculate these values

The figures for #ead595 come from standard color math, shown so you can check them. We convert from sRGB to each space with the standard formulas, so the codes match what design tools show. The coated and uncoated cmyk builds differ because uncoated stock absorbs more ink and gains dot, so the same color needs a heavier, slightly duller build on press. The Pantone value is the closest reference by perceptual color distance and should be treated as a starting point, not a guaranteed match.
